Image for Church of St. Mary the Virgin (various locations)

Church of St. Mary the Virgin (various locations)

Church of St. Mary the Virgin refers to several historic Anglican churches dedicated to Mary, the mother of Jesus, often serving as central community worship spaces. These churches typically feature traditional architecture, periodical services, and are involved in local spiritual and cultural activities. Named after Mary, they symbolize faith, community, and historical continuity within their regions. Notable examples include churches in Oxford, Oxfordshire, and other towns, often with rich histories dating back centuries. These churches serve both as places of worship and as cultural landmarks, reflecting centuries of religious and social heritage.